* this depends on newer bitbake
* similar to world target, but collects all PACKAGES
* recipes marked with EXCLUDE_FROM_WORLD are excluded from world as well
  as world-image
* recipes marked with EXCLUDE_FROM_WORLD_IMAGE are excluded completely
  from world-image, sometimes you can build 2 recipes in same sysroot,
  but cannot install them in the same image
* PACKAGES listed in EXCLUDE_PACKAGES_FROM_WORLD_IMAGE are also
  excluded. You can remove e.g. ${PN}-dbg, but keep all other PACKAGES.
